We hope you got benefit from reading it, now let’s go back to tandoori chicken recipe. To make tandoori chicken you need 12 ingredients and 5 steps. Here is how you do it.

The ingredients needed to prepare Tandoori Chicken:
  1. Take 2 lbs skinless, boneless chicken thighs
  2. You need 4 tablespoons natural yogurt
  3. Take 3 cloves garlic, minced
  4. You need 1 tablespoon ground coriander
  5. Prepare 1 tablespoon ground cumin
  6. Provide 2 teaspoons turmeric
  7. Prepare 1 teaspoon chilli powder
  8. You need 1 tablespoon garam masala
  9. Use 2 tablespoons paprika
  10. Use Juice of 1 lemon
  11. Prepare 1/2 teaspoon salt
  12. Use 3 tablespoons groundnut (or sunflower or canola) oil
Instructions to make Tandoori Chicken:
  1. Trim any excess fat from the chicken thighs, then cut the thighs into thirds, roughly equal in size.
  2. Mix all the other ingredients together in a small bowl. Combine well.
  3. Place the chicken pieces in a large bowl (or ziplock bag) and add the marinade. Mix well so that the chicken is evenly covered, cover with cling film and leave in the fridge to marinate for at least 1 hour.
  4. Remove chicken from fridge and bring up to room temperature. Preheat the oven to 180°C/356°F. To cook, spread the chicken pieces out on a couple of baking trays ensuring they are not touching. Place in the preheated oven and bake for 30-35 minutes.
  5. Enjoy with rice, naan bread or salad!
